Why has sustainability become a must-have purchasing criterion?

Sustainable consumption is not a passing fad. The data confirm this: according to Ipsos and Fondazione Symbola research, quality is the first driver that drives sustainable choices for 69.6 percent of Italians, followed by concern for climate change (22 percent) and ethics (7.4 percent). This means that the modern consumer now associates sustainability with perceived product quality.

For companies, the message is clear: those who do not authentically communicate their environmental commitment risk losing customers. More than 60 percent of brands globally are moving toward green promotional items, according to Market Reports World (2026) data. The question is no longer “whether” to invest in sustainable gadgets, but “how” to do so strategically and effectively.

Younger generations also confirm this direction. Gen Z and Millennials show a willingness to pay up to 30 percent more for eco-responsible products (PwC, 2025). This finding is especially relevant for companies that participate in trade shows, events, or employer branding campaigns aimed at a younger audience.

What makes a promotional gadget truly sustainable?

An eco-friendly gadget is not simply a recyclable item. To call itself sustainable, a promotional item must meet several criteria throughout its life cycle: from the choice of raw materials to production, from durability to eventual disposal.

What materials characterize green gadgets?

The most widely used materials in sustainable merchandising include bamboo (a plant that grows up to 91 cm per day and absorbs 35 percent more CO₂ than traditional trees), recycled rPET plastic (derived from the recovery of PET bottles), organic and Fairtrade-certified cotton, recycled or FSC-certified paper, and innovative materials such as agro-food waste.

Certifications: how to verify that a gadget is really eco?

Environmental certifications are the most reliable tool for distinguishing a truly sustainable product from greenwashing. Among the main ones to look for: G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) for textiles, GRS (Global Recycled Standard) for recycled materials, FSC for paper and wood, Oeko-Tex for textile safety, and Cradle to Cradle for complete product circularity.

What are the most effective sustainable gadgets for promotional campaigns?

Not all green gadgets have the same impact. The most effective ones combine three elements: everyday utility (the recipient actually uses them), brand visibility (the logo is naturally displayed), and credible environmental message (the material or design tells a green story).

Reusable flasks and bottles

They are among the most popular sustainable gadgets. Water bottles made of recycled material combine practicality, design and an environmental message. Perfect for sporting events, trade shows, welcome kits and corporate gifts.

Eco-friendly pens and writing instruments

The personalized pen remains one of the most widely distributed gadgets ever: 60 percent of people use a pen 5 to 10 times a day. In the eco version – made of bamboo, rPET or recycled materials – it becomes an everyday brand awareness vehicle with reduced environmental impact. Natural and regenerative gadgets

A fast-growing trend is regenerative merchandising: gadgets that not only reduce impact, but generate life. Seed bombs, plantable seed cards and personalized living plants represent a unique way to make your mark. Gifting something that grows is a powerful brand message, perfect for CSR campaigns and product launches.

Fairtrade cotton shoppers and bags

Personalized shopping bags are one of the gadgets with the highest public visibility. In organic or Fairtrade cotton versions, they combine functionality, aesthetics and social engagement. They are ideal for point-of-sale, events and sustainable packaging.

How do you customize an eco-friendly gadget without compromising its sustainability?

Eco-friendly personalization techniques include screen printing with water-based inks, laser engraving (which does not use chemicals) and low-impact UV digital printing. Be-Bloomer guides each client in choosing the technique best suited to the material and the desired result.

What certifications should I look for in a sustainable gadget?

The main certifications to check are GOTS for organic textiles, GRS for recycled materials, FSC for paper and wood from responsibly managed forests, Oeko-Tex for textile safety, and Fairtrade for fair trade assurance.
